I have no option to disconnect my facebook in the preferences.
I want to delete facebook, but still use Spotify.
What should I do.
Thanks.

Hey! Welcome to the community 🙂
There is no way to seperate a Spotify account created using Facebook from Facebook, so you will need to make a new account.
